More information : Problems with PC Card modems in Windows 2000.

Firstly, open device manager and select the properties for the modem;  Click on the resources tab:

 Then click the 'Set Configuration Manually' button.

Uncheck the 'Use automatic settings' tick box.  This will allow you to manually configure the modem.

From the drop down menu, select 'Basic Configuration 0004':

 
Highlight 'Input/Output range' and click the 'Change Settings..' button.

Select an appropriate I/O range that fits into your PCI bus range (such as the one shown above.)  Click OK.

Highlight 'Interrupt Request' and click the 'Change Settings..' button.

Select any free Interrupt and click OK.

You should then see the new properties you have set for this device, similar to those below:

Click OK and confirm the assignment of properties as below:

By clicking on the 'Yes' button.
